What does the Bible say about being fervent in spirit?

The Bible encourages believers to be fervent in spirit, serving the Lord diligently (Romans 12:11).

Romans 12:11 states that we should not be slothful in business, but fervent in spirit, serving the Lord. This fervency reflects the zeal that the Lord Jesus displayed during His earthly ministry. The call to be fervent in spirit means that we should engage in our tasks with a passion that comes from our love for Christ, recognizing that our service is ultimately for Him and His glory. Just as Christ was not sluggish in fulfilling His Father’s work, we too are encouraged to be diligent and zealous in our service.
Scripture References: Romans 12:11, 2 Corinthians 5:14, Revelation 3:15-16
